Chapter 14
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| Totalitarianism | a theory of government in which a single party or leader controls the economic, social, and cultural lives of its people |
| Joseph Stalin | took Lenins place a head of the communist part. "man of steel" |
| Benito Mussolini | founded the fascist party |
| Adolf Hitler | led the Nazi party, world war I vet, person who teetered on the brink of madness |
| Anti-Semitic | prejudice and discrimination against jewish people |
| Spanish Civil War | bloody conflict that raged from 1936-1939 |
| appeasement | policy of granting concessions in order to keep the peace |
| Anschluss | bunion of germany and austria in 1933 |
| Munich Pact | agreement made between germany , italy, great britain, and france in 1938 that sacrificed the sudetenland to preserve peace |
| blitzkrieg | "lightning war" that emphasized the use of speed and firepower to penetrate deep into the enemy's territory |
| Axis Powers | group of countries led by germany, italy, and japan that fought the allies in World War II |
| Allies | group of countries led by Britain, France, the United States, and the Soviet Union that fought the axis powers |
| Winston Churchill | New prime minister, cautioned parliament, "wars are not won by evacuations." |
| Neutrality Act of 1939 | This provision allowed belligerent nations to buy goods and arms in the United States if they paid cash and carried the merchandise on their own ships |
| Tripartite Pact | agreement that created an alliance between Germany, Italy, and Japan |
| Lend-Lease Pact | act passed in 1941 that allowed president roosevelt to sell or lend war supplies to any country whose defense he considered vital to the safety of the United States |
| Atlantic Charter | a joint declaration made in August 1941 by Great Britain and the United Stated, that endorsed national self-determination and an international system of general security |
| Hideki Tojo | 1941 became the Japanese prime minister |
| Pearl Harbor | American military base attacked by the Japanese in December 7, 1941 |
| WAC Womens Army Corp | US Army group established during WWII so that women could serve in noncombat roles |
| Douglas MacArthur | commander of the US army forces in Asia, struggled to hold the US positions in the Philippines with little support |
| Bataan Death March | the forced march of American and Filipino prisoners of war under brutal conditions by the Japanese military |
| Battle of Coral Sea | WWII battle that took place between Japanese and American aircraft carriers |
